Types of Churches in North Little Rock

Modern North Little Rock Churches

These congregations feature band-led worship, casual dress, and practical teaching, often meeting in updated spaces near McCain Boulevard, Lakewood, and the Argenta Arts District. They attract young professionals and families along the Arkansas River Trail who want active kids’ ministries and weekday community groups.

Historic and Liturgical Churches

Long-established congregations in Park Hill and the Argenta historic core offer organ music, choirs, and structured liturgy in mid-century sanctuaries with stained glass. These churches often serve multi-generational families and host seasonal services tied to the traditional church calendar.

Multicultural and Spanish-Language Churches

With growing Latino and immigrant communities around Levy, Camp Robinson Road, and the Pike Avenue corridor, many congregations offer bilingual worship and Spanish-language ministries. These churches often provide ESL classes, food outreach, and cultural celebrations that connect newer residents with long-time neighbors.

Military-Friendly North Little Rock Churches

Proximity to Camp Robinson shapes congregations that schedule around drill weekends and offer support groups for Guard members, veterans, and their families. Many are clustered near Remount Road and Burns Park, providing childcare, counseling referrals, and service opportunities tailored to military life.
